The piece of hardware inside the mi pad is nothing short of monstrous but the culprit here is the software which is not optimized for the hardware of such caliber. I am not into the heating club because such powerful hardware will heat up with graphic intensive tasks.
Problem is ram management which is pathetic. you run any music app in background and then browse on chrome, after 5 minutes music will stop because the system thrives for some free RAM and then you press home button and you see the launcher getting redrawn again, then you switch back to chrome and see chrome loading websites from scratch.
The way ram management is done it seems like the device has only 512mb ram. and you will never figure out who eats that much ram even when the tablet is lying idle for few hours. the whole miui software is a beta or alpha version of a final product(however miui in my mi4 is great). wish there was some stock android goodness to the mi pad.
